My breakfast this morning needed a little bit of planning and preparation. Though this preparation isn't much work or complicated at all.
I prepared some spelt grains by filling them into a thermos flask, cooking some water and adding it to the grains. I also add a dash of sea salt. Then I went to bed and let the grains soak the water overnight.
Spelt is an excellent source of protein, dietary fiber, several B vitamins and minerals. Richest nutrient contents include manganese, phosphorus and niacin. Spelt contains much carbohydrates and is low in fat.
In the morning I drained the spelt. The result looks like this:
The grains are soft and fluffy almost creamy on the outside with a little bit leftover bite inside.
To increase the nutritional richness mix it with oatflakes and wheatbran which brings a lot of iron with them. The fruitiness and some bite comes from an apple cut into fine pieces. I mix everything with a plantal milk. Today it was an Almond-Rice-Drink.
Some pumpkin seeds make it more crunchy and some granola adds a little bit of sweetness and fun to my bowl.
Pumpkin seeds are calorie-dense and an excellent source of protein, dietary fiber, niacin, iron, zinc, manganese, magnesium and phosphorus, riboflavin, folate, pantothenic acid, sodium and potassium.
